The Columbia is a staple of Tampa and is the oldest restaurant in the state. It's definitely worth going to at least once. For another good eat (and awesome beer), check out Tampa Bay Brewing Company, right around the corner in Centro Ybor. Leave Ybor and go into Seminole Heights to check out The Refinery, Fodder & Shine, The Front Porch, and The Independent for some more food choices as well.

The question is whether you want a Tampa experience or you just want good food, if you are into good food then I would go to Edison Food+Drink Lab, Ava, Yummi house bistro, Sideberns, Cafe Ponte, Six Tables, Piquant, Anise, the Seminole Heights places mentioned before, but none of those places are particular to the area they can be in anytown, USA. If you want Tampa/Florida atmosphere then the Colonnade (even though is a tiny step above red lobster), Columbia (aside from cubans is not very good), Frenchy's, Ulele (not a fan of their menu), Berns, Jackson's Bistro those places are sort of unique to the area whether is ovelooking bayshore or downtown, on the beach, Old (Columbia).
